TINCheck by Sovos is a compliance-focused tax identity verification solution designed to help businesses validate taxpayer identification numbers (TINs) before submitting forms such as 1099s. Developed by Sovos, a global compliance software provider, the platform integrates TIN matching, IRS validation workflows, and reporting tools into a centralized system.

The product primarily targets organizations dealing with high volumes of vendor or contractor payments, where incorrect TIN data can lead to IRS penalties, backup withholding obligations, and administrative overhead.

Unlike generic data validation tools, TINCheck is purpose-built for U.S. tax compliance, aligning closely with IRS TIN Matching programs and regulatory requirements.

Key Features

1. Real-Time and Batch TIN Matching

  • Validate TIN and name combinations against IRS databases
  • Supports both real-time API calls and bulk uploads
  • Reduces error rates before filing 1099 forms

2. IRS Integration

  • Direct integration with IRS TIN Matching system
  • Helps ensure compliance with IRS Publication 2108-A
  • Minimizes B-Notice risk

3. Backup Withholding Management

  • Identifies mismatched records triggering withholding requirements
  • Helps organizations proactively apply or avoid backup withholding

4. Workflow Automation

  • Automates validation during onboarding or payment workflows
  • Reduces manual review processes
  • Integrates with ERP, HR, and AP systems

5. Reporting and Audit Trails

  • Detailed validation logs for compliance audits
  • Tracks submission history and validation outcomes
  • Useful for internal governance and external audits

6. Data Security and Compliance

  • Enterprise-grade security controls
  • Designed to meet regulatory standards for handling sensitive taxpayer data

Pros and Cons

Pros

  • Purpose-built for IRS TIN compliance
  • Supports both real-time and batch validation
  • Strong audit and reporting capabilities
  • Scales well for enterprise use
  • Reduces risk of penalties and B-Notices

Cons

  • Pricing transparency is limited
  • Primarily focused on U.S. compliance (less useful globally)
  • Requires integration effort for full automation
  • May be excessive for small businesses with low filing volume

Verdict

TINCheck by Sovos is a specialized compliance tool that excels in reducing tax reporting errors and ensuring IRS alignment. It is particularly valuable for organizations with large vendor networks or frequent 1099 filings. While it may not be necessary for smaller businesses, enterprises will benefit from its automation, audit readiness, and integration capabilities.

Its biggest strengths lie in accuracy, compliance alignment, and scalability, though the lack of transparent pricing and its U.S.-centric scope are notable limitations.
